- the present invention relates to a pallet on which cargo is placed and used to transport the cargo.
- an IC tag is attached, and the type and quantity of the cargo to be transported are read by reading data recorded on the IC tag. It relates to a pallet that can be grasped and inspected.
- a pallet In a distribution center of a manufacturer or a distribution center of a sales company, a pallet is used to carry containers such as cardboard boxes storing products and parts. Various containers are loaded on the pallet, and products and parts are shipped and delivered by being lifted and transferred by the fork of the forklift while the containers are loaded. In such a distribution center, it is necessary to inspect the type and quantity of products and parts shipped and delivered. For this reason, barcodes for identifying products and parts are affixed to the outer surface of each container, and individual barcode information is read by a barcode reader for inspection.
- Patent Document 1 discloses a technology for sorting loaded cargo by pasting a barcode indicating the type of cargo loaded and the destination to the side of the pallet and reading the barcode with a barcode reader. Has been.
- An IC tag has a feature that it can write and read a lot of information on the type and number of products and parts. By using this feature, the following inspection can be performed.
- System becomes possible.
- the distribution center on the shipping side sends information about products and parts stored in one container to the IC tag, writes it on the IC tag, and then attaches the IC tag to the outer surface of the container before shipping.
- the information written in the tag is sent to the distribution center via the communication network.
- the distribution center on the delivery side receives the container, it reads the IC tag attached to the outer surface of the container, and compares the read information with the information sent from the distribution center on the shipment side. Perform inspection. In such a system, it is possible to inspect products and parts in the container without having to read the barcode of each individual container, so that the inspection work can be performed efficiently.
- FIG. 8 shows a pallet 100 on which an IC tag is attached in order to perform such inspection.
- the pallet 100 has a pallet body 105 on which a container (not shown) is placed, and an IC tag 200 is attached to the outer surface of the pallet body 105 by pasting.
- the pallet body 105 has girder portions 106, 107 in the left and right portions and the central portion, and a flat cubic shape in which upper and lower side plates 110 and 120 are provided on the upper and lower portions of these girder portions 10 6, 107. It is molded into.
- a plurality of IC tags 200 are affixed to the outer surface of one pallet body 100, and the same information is written in the plurality of IC tags 200 affixed to one pallet body 105. At the time of inspection, it is also confirmed that all the information in the plurality of IC tags 200 attached to one pallet body 105 is the same.

- the pallet 100 has been standardized to some extent in shape and size due to the efficiency of transportation and storage and ease of work.
- those having approximately the same size are used so that they can be arranged side by side for ease of work at the time of shipment and carry-in.
- the IC tag 200 is affixed to the outer surface of the girder 107 of the central part of the pallet body 105 in consideration of the affixing workability.
- the left pallet 100 and the right pallet 100 are brought into contact with the side surface of the left pallet 100 and the side surface of the right pallet 100 facing each other, as indicated by arrow A.
- the IC tags 200 attached to the girder 107 in the central portion of each pallet body 105 overlap each other. It is. That is, the hatched IC tags 200 in FIG. 8 overlap each other.
- the present invention has been made in consideration of such conventional problems. Even when pallets of the same shape and the same size are aligned side by side, the IC tags of the pallets adjacent to each other are arranged. The purpose of this is to provide a pallet that can reliably transmit and receive with an IC tag and can improve inspection efficiency.

- the pallet 1 of this embodiment includes a pallet body 3 and an IC tag 2 attached to the pallet body 3.
- the upper side plate 4 and the lower side plate 5 face each other, and these face plates 4, 5 are connected via a plurality of beam portions 6, 7, 8.
- the upper side plate 4 and the lower side plate 5 are formed with a number of slit-like or mesh-like drain holes 9.
- the pallet body 3 is entirely formed of a synthetic resin so that the outer shape is a substantially cubic or flat cuboid. In this embodiment, it is formed in a flat, substantially cubic outer shape. Thus, by making it a substantially cubic shape, it is possible to align the pallet bodies 3 in a side-by-side configuration with the side surfaces abutted.
- the pallet body 3 can also be formed of aluminum or wood made of synthetic resin.
- the girder parts 6, 7, and 8 that connect the upper and lower face plates 4 and 5 are provided on the front and rear and left and right side surfaces of the pallet body 3, respectively. It is the length of penetration.
- the girder part on one side of the pallet body 3 is composed of a girder part 7 in the center part and girder parts 6 and 8 in the left and right parts, between the girder part 6 on the left side and the girder part 7 in the middle part.
- the IC tag 2 is attached to four side surfaces of the pallet body 3 by pasting.
- the IC tag 2 attached to the side is filled with information such as the type, number, production lot, and other information of products and parts in containers such as cardboard boxes loaded on the pallet 1. The information is read.
- the IC tag 2 on each side surface is attached to the outer surface of one of the left and right girder parts 6 and 8, excluding the girder part 7 in the central part.
- the IC tag 2 is attached to the outer surface of the beam portion 6 located on the left side of each side surface of the pallet body 3. In this way, by attaching the IC tag 2 to either the left or right girder 6 or 8 excluding the central girder 7, the pallet 1 is aligned side by side by abutting the side of the pallet body 3. Even if it is done, the IC tag 2 will not overlap between adjacent pallets 1.
- FIG. 2 shows a state in which pallets 1 having the same shape and the same dimensions are aligned side by side as indicated by an arrow A, and the side surfaces of adjacent pallets 1 are brought into contact with each other by forming the side by side.
- the left pallet 1 has its right side faced with the left side face 1 of the right pallet 1.
- each pallet 1 has IC tag 2 attached to the outer surface of the left beam 6 so that the pallets 1 face each other as shown by hatching and chain lines even when they are aligned side by side. If the UC tag 2 does not exist on the side of the pallet body 3 of the pallet 1, the pallet body 1 overlaps at the location.
- FIG. 3 shows an example of the UHF band IC tag 2, which includes an IC chip 12 on a thin base sheet 11 and an antenna 13 connected to the IC chip 12.
- the antenna 13 is formed by printing conductive metal.
- This UHF band IC tag 2 has an adhesive applied to the entire surface of the base sheet 11. After peeling off the release paper 14, the adhesive surface (the surface on which the IC chip 12 and antenna 13 are formed) is placed on the side of the container body 3. Can be attached to the container body 3 by pasting.

- FIG. 4 shows an example of the inspection operation in the distribution center of the sales company.
- a leader 'writer 21 for inspection is installed at the entrance or roof.
- the reader / writer 21 is connected to a monitor 22, and the monitor 22 displays the inspection result visually.
- the knot 1 is loaded with containers 25 containing products and is transported to the distribution center by truck 23. Then, the pallet 1 is unloaded from the truck 23 under the leader / writer 21 with the containers 25 loaded thereon, and arranged side by side in an aligned manner.
- the pallet 1 loaded with the container 25 has a UHF band IC tag 2 capable of long-distance communication on its side even if it is away from the reader 'writer 21.
- the 21 can read the information reliably and perform inspection quickly.
- the forklift 27 of the forklift 27 is loaded into the forklift space 27, 10a (see FIG. 1) and then transported by the forklift 27.
- the UHF band IC tag 2 By using the UHF band IC tag 2 in this way, inspection in the aligned state of the pallet 1 and inspection at a place away from the reader 'writer 21 can be performed, so inspection work can be speeded up. .
- a passive UHF band IC tag is used as the IC tag. Nositive tags do not normally operate because they do not have a battery.
- the antenna on the reader / writer 21 side transmits radio waves to the UHF band IC tag 2, and the tag 2 sends the radio waves to the rectifier circuit of the IC chip 12 and converts it to direct current. This direct current is used as energy.
- FIG. 5 shows a pallet 1A according to the second embodiment of the present invention.
- the pallet body 3 of the pallet 1A is a flat and substantially cubic body, and the left side spar 6, the center spar 7, and the right spar 8 are provided on the four side surfaces thereof.
- the upper side plate 4 and the lower side plate 5 face each other through the girders 6, 7, and 8.
- a noisy UHF band IC tag is used as the IC tag 2.
- the IC tag 2 in this embodiment is attached to the side surface except the outer surface of the beam portions 6, 7, and 8.
- the IC tag 2 is attached to the side facing the fork insertion spaces 10 and 10a in the beam portions 6 and 7.
- the IC tags 2 are mutually connected between the pallet bodies 3 in the adjacent pallet 1A. Do not overlap. Therefore, as in the first embodiment, the inspection work for the cargo loaded on the pallet 1A can be quickly and labor-saving.
- the width of the fork insertion spaces 10 and 10a is set to such an extent that the above-mentioned space is formed between the side surface of the girder portion to which the IC tag 2 is attached and the fork.
- FIG. 6 shows a pallet 1B in the third embodiment of the present invention.
- a passive UHF band IC tag 2 is attached to the central beam portion 7 and the left and right beam portions 6 and 8.
- the IC tag 2 is attached to the back side surface that is not attached to the outer surface. That is, the IC tag 2 is attached to the inner surface facing the inner side of the pallet body 3 in each of the girder parts 6, 7, 8.
- the IC tag 2 By attaching the IC tag 2 to the inner surface of the girders 6, 7, and 8 as described above, the IC tag 2 can overlap between adjacent pallets 1B even if the pallets 1B are aligned side by side. And disappear. Therefore, inspection work for cargo loaded on the pallet 1B can be performed quickly and labor-saving.
- the fork inserted from the fork insertion spaces 10 and 10a comes into contact with the IC tag 2 by attaching the IC tag 2 to the inner surface of the girders 6, 7, and 8. There is nothing to do. As a result, the IC tag 2 can be prevented from being damaged.
- FIG. 7 shows a pallet 1C in the fourth embodiment of the present invention.
- IC Tag 2 is attached to the inner surface of lower side plate 5 by pasting. That is, the IC tag 2 is attached to the inner surface of the lower side plate 5 facing the upper side plate 4.
- the IC tags 2 do not overlap each other between adjacent pallets 1C. Therefore, the inspection work of the cargo loaded on the pallet 1C can be quickly and labor-saving.
- the corners are slightly offset from the respective fork passages. It is preferably attached.
- the IC tag 2 can also be attached to the area including the drain hole 9 depending on its size.
- the adhesive applied to the base sheet 11 has adhesive strength, the lower side plate It is possible to affix to 5 reliably.
- a passive UHF band IC tag is used as the IC tag 2.
- the IC tag 2 may be attached to both the inner surface of the lower side plate 5 and the inner surface of the upper side plate 4.
- the IC tag 2 may be attached only to the inner surface of the upper side plate 4. . Even in these cases, in order to prevent contact with the fork and damage due to contact, it is preferable that the fork passage is attached to a position offset toward the girder side.
